The present study investigated the relationship between organizational culture and employee's psychological contract. The study also sought to examine the different dimensions of Organizational culture on two types of psychological contract (relational and transactional psychological contract). Using random sampling procedure, data were collected from 300 employees working in two public sector organizations in Bhutan. Correlation and regression analysis were carried out to test hypotheses of the study. Results revealed that organizational culture does influence the employee's psychological contract. It was also found that supportive and achievement culture positively and significantly influenced transactional psychological contract; whereas power and role culture significantly and positively influenced employee's transactional psychological contract. Implications of the study have been explicated in the research.
